One of the most notable places in San Jose is the Rosicrucian Egyptian Museum. Nestled in a beautifully landscaped park, this museum houses the largest collection of ancient Egyptian artifacts in the western United States. Visitors can admire stunning displays of mummies, jewelry, and other relics that provide insight into an ancient civilization. The museum also offers guided tours that delve into the history of Egypt and its influence on contemporary society.
Just a short distance away lies the San Jose Museum of Art, an essential stop for contemporary art lovers. This museum showcases works from both renowned and emerging artists, with a particular focus on California artists. Its rotating exhibits highlight different themes and mediums, ensuring a fresh experience with each visit.
For those seeking outdoor experiences, Discovery Meadow is a perfect spot for family outings and festivals. This sprawling park features lush green spaces, a playground for children, and picnic areas. Events are often held here, fostering a sense of community among the residents. Just adjacent to the meadow is the Children’s Discovery Museum of San Jose, where kids can engage in interactive exhibits designed to stimulate curiosity and creativity.
No visit to San Jose would be complete without exploring the historic Winchester Mystery House. This sprawling estate, shrouded in mystery, is famous for its peculiar architecture, including staircases that lead nowhere and doors that open into walls. The estate was owned by Sarah Winchester, widow of the inventor of the famous rifle, and is said to be haunted by the spirits of those killed by the rifle. Guided tours are available, offering a chance to learn about the home’s bizarre construction and its intriguing backstory.
